Lifespan Respite Care Reauthorization Act of 2025
Sponsored By: Representative Langworthy
Introduced
Summary
Expands and extends lifespan respite care by broadening who counts as a family caregiver and renewing program authorization through 2029. The bill would replace the phrase "unpaid adult" with "unpaid individual" in Section 2901(5) of the Public Health Service Act and update the funding authorization to cover fiscal years 2025 through 2029.
Show full summary
- Families and caregivers: More unpaid individuals could be recognized as family caregivers for the program, which may widen who can be served.
- Service providers and grant programs: Lifespan respite grants and programs would have authorized federal funding through FY2025–FY2029, replacing the prior 2020–2024 authorization.
